Изобретение относитс  к очистке химическими способами и может быть использовано при очистке воды в осветлител х на водоподготовительных установках тепловых электростанций и промпредпри тнй.The invention relates to the purification by chemical methods and can be used in the purification of water in clarifiers in water treatment plants of thermal power plants and industrial enterprises.

Известен способ автоматнческого регулировани  процесса нзвесткованн  воды в осветлителе путем дозировани  известкового молока в зависимости от электропроводности обрабатываемой воды во входной зоне осветлнтеЛ  (1|.There is a method of automatic regulation of the process of water injection into the clarifier by metering milk of lime depending on the conductivity of the treated water in the inlet zone of the clarifier (1 |.

Нанболее близким к предлагаемому по технической сущности  вл етс  способ, регулировани  процесса известковани  воды путем изменени  дозы извести, подаваемой в обрабатываемую воду в зависимости от экстремального значени  электропроводности известкованной воДы в пробоотбориом потоке. {2}.Most closely to the proposed technical essence is the method of regulating the process of water lime by changing the dose of lime supplied to the treated water depending on the extreme value of the electrical conductivity of the lime water in the sampling stream. {2}.

Недостатком указанного способа  вл етс  то, что при его использовании 1юндуктометрические датчики из-за повышенного содержани  Э пробе механических примесей и хнмически активной среды либо изнашиваютс , либо на поверхност х измерительных  чеек накапливаютс  отложени , что снижает точность и надежность регулировани  и повышает затраты на обслуживание. Кроме этого, на абсолютную величину электропроводности существенно вли ют температурные и другие переменныеThe disadvantage of this method is that when it is used, the induction sensors, due to the increased content of E, the sample of mechanical impurities and the chemically active medium either wear out, or deposits accumulate on the surfaces of the measuring cells, which reduces the accuracy and reliability of control and increases maintenance costs. In addition, temperature and other variables significantly affect the absolute value of electrical conductivity.

исходные услови  (например, общее солесодержание исходной воды), что ограничивает область применени  нзвестного способа регулировани  на химводоочистках с переменными услови ми работы.baseline conditions (e.g., the total salt content of the source water), which limits the scope of application of the well-known method of control in water treatment systems with varying conditions of operation.

5 Целью изобретени   вл етс  повышение точности , надежности н Снижение эксплуатационных затрат..5 The aim of the invention is to improve the accuracy, reliability and decrease in operating costs.

Поставленна  цель достнгаетс  тем, что стабилизируют расход известкованной воды в JQ пробоотборном потоке, тнтруют эту воду исходной водой по экстремальному значению электропроводности получаемой смеси, и в зависимости от количества затраченной на титрооание исходной воды измен ют дозу подаваемой в обрабатываемую воду извести.This goal is achieved by stabilizing the consumption of lime water in the JQ sampling stream, tying this water with the source water according to the extreme electrical conductivity of the mixture obtained, and depending on the amount of source water spent on titration of the source water, lime is fed.

Изобретение по сн етс  чертежом.The invention is illustrated in the drawing.

Функциональна  схема регулировани  дл  осуществлени  предлагаемого способа содержит прОбоотборное устройство, включающее пробозаборную точку 1, установленную во входной зоне осветлител  2, смеситель 3 кондуктометрическогО титратора 4, в качестве которого применен экстремальный регул тор электропроводности с кондуктометрическим датчиком 5 на выходе из смесител , подключенным к регулирующему устройству экстремума 6, выход - которого через исполнительный механизм 7 соеThe functional control circuit for the implementation of the proposed method includes a sampling device, including sampling point 1 installed in the input zone of the clarifier 2, mixer 3, conductometric titrator 4, for which an extreme conductivity regulator is used with a conductometric sensor 5 at the mixer outlet connected to the control device extremum 6, output - which through the actuator 7 soy
